3 Reasons to Always Take Your Dog to a Professional Groomer

1. They Have Professional Tools

dog groomingDog grooming tools are different than the scissors and electric razors used for human haircuts. Dog grooming professionals use a wide range of clippers and and scissors to cut various fur lengths and textures. While grooming, they use an adjustable table with a lead to keep the dog in place. This makes the process easier and therefore keeps animal anxiety to a minimum.

2. You Can Expect a Thorough Clean

Your groomer will take special care while grooming and bathing your dog. If your dog has matted fur or anything stuck in their hair, the groomer can cut those sections out, leaving the pet’s coat shining. They can also de-shed your dog, meaning less to clean up on your clothes and furniture. While bathing them, the groomer will ensure their fur and skin are as clean as possible, noting any skin issues that need to be addressed. If your pet was recently sprayed by a skunk, these professionals can bathe them to address the smell. They are trained to handle even the ickiest circumstances. 

3. They Will Cater to Your Dog’s Breed

Every breed has a unique coat and will need a specific grooming regimen. For example, cocker spaniels will need to be shaved with clippers while huskies require de-shedding. Groomers know exactly which tools to use with each breed and what cuts are most typical. They can also give you tips to care for your dog’s coat in between grooming appointments.
